Massena Hospital is a 25-bed hospital. Might have to go to Canton or Ogdensburg for a family doctor (45 minutes by car). Most things serious get referred to Syracuse or Burlington (3 hours away by car).

AFAIK, Cost[1] is "theoretically" nothing if annual income is less than the federal poverty line ($15,650 for an individuality). And might as well be free for an income up to $39,125.

Alcoa (Aluminum Smelter, *cheap electricity*) was the major industry in the area. Massena plant now produces 85% less aluminum compared to ~15 years ago (AFAICT), leading to something of a ghost town (and cheap housing).

Limited internet connections (speed and/or data-caps). Something like Hughesnet (satellite ISP) couldn't stream more than 240p from youtube during peek times. The data-cap coerced users to do downloads between 2am to 6am.
